Iarrann go leor daoine
Cad is cláir ann?
Agus conas a tháinig tú chun bheith i do ríomhchláraitheoir?
Agus cá dtosóidh mé?
Lean an snáithe seo liom
Maidir leis an sainmhíniú ar theangacha ríomhchlárúcháin
agus cineálacha teangacha ríomhchlárúcháin
C teanga:
Java teanga:
C++ teanga:
Teanga Python:
Teanga Ruby:
Teanga Php:
Teanga Pascal:
leibhéil teanga cláir
ardleibhéil
leibhéal íseal
Glúine teangacha ríomhchlárúcháin:
An chéad ghlúin (1GL):
Dara glúin (2GL):
An tríú glúin (3GL):
Ceathrú glúin (4GL):
An cúigiú glúin (5GL):
Gcéad dul síos, sainigh teangacha ríomhchlárúcháin
Is féidir teangacha ríomhchlárúcháin a shainmhíniú mar shraith orduithe scríofa de réir sraith rialacha sonracha i dteanga a thuigeann agus a fheidhmíonn an ríomhaire.Chun an ríomhchláraitheoir é a roghnú, agus tá gach ceann de na teangacha seo uathúil ón gceann eile le na gnéithe agus na nuashonruithe a tugadh isteach dó le teacht roimh an gceann roimhe atá ar siúl agus á scaipeadh, agus is féidir leis na teangacha seo tréithe a roinnt eatarthu, agus is fiú a lua go bhforbraíonn siad go huathoibríoch i gcomhar le forbairt an ríomhaire , is ea is mó an dul chun cinn atá déanta i bhforbairtí Ríomhairí leictreonacha Ba mhó chun cinn forbairt na dteangacha seo.
Cineálacha teangacha ríomhchlárúcháin
Áirítear go leor cineálacha faoi liosta na dteangacha ríomhchlárúcháin, agus i measc na gcineálacha is tábhachtaí agus is forleithne tá:
C. teanga
Tá an teanga ríomhchlárúcháin C ar cheann de na teangacha códaithe idirnáisiúnta, agus tá tábhacht mhór ag baint léi toisc go dtógtar go leor teangacha ríomhchlárúcháin nua-aimseartha uirthi, mar a dhéantar in C++ agus Java, agus téann a forbairt siar go dtí na seachtóidí. ag Ken Thompson, Brian Kernighan agus Dennis Ritchie, agus tugadh é chun críocha córas oibriúcháin Unix a fhorbairt agus oibriú air.
Java
Bhí James Gosling in ann an teanga Java a fhorbairt i 1992 le linn a chuid oibre laistigh de shaotharlanna Sun Microsystems. Is fiú a thabhairt faoi deara gur tháinig a fhorbairt chun ról an aigne smaointeoireachta a imirt i mbainistiú agus i bhfeidhmiú gléasanna feidhmchláir chliste ar nós teilifís idirghníomhach agus eile,. agus tagann a fhorbairt bunaithe ar C++.
C.++
Tá sé rangaithe mar theanga ilúsáide atá dírithe ar oibiachtaí, agus tháinig sé chun cinn mar chéim forbartha don teanga C, agus tá an teanga seo glactha go forleathan agus tóir i measc dearthóirí feidhmchláir le comhéadain chasta, agus tá sé uathúil ina chumas déileáil leis. sonraí casta.
Python
Tréithe na teanga seo le simplíocht agus le héascaíocht i scríobh agus i léamh a orduithe, agus braitheann sí ina cuid oibre ar an modh ríomhchláraithe atá dírithe ar oibiachtaí.Cad a thugann comhairle don thosaitheoirí tosú ar a thuras oideachais ar theangacha ríomhchlárúcháin i Python.
Teanga Ruby
Is teanga ríomhchláraithe Ruby í teanga atá dírithe ar oibiachtaí. Is é sin, is féidir é a úsáid i go leor réimsí, agus tá sé tréithrithe mar theanga oibiachta íon, chomh maith le sraith airíonna a bhaineann go sonrach le teangacha feidhmiúla.
Php.teanga
Tháinig Php le húsáid i bhforbairt agus i ríomhchlárú feidhmchláir gréasáin, chomh maith leis an bhféidearthacht é a úsáid chun cláir atá ann cheana féin a scaoileadh agus a fhorbairt, agus tá sé foinse oscailte, tá an cumas aige tacaíocht a sholáthar do ríomhchlárú atá dírithe ar oibiachtaí, agus tá an cumas aige obair thacaíochta ar go leor córais oibriúcháin, lena n-áirítear Windows agus Linux.
Teanga Pascal
Cloíonn soiléireacht, stóinseacht agus éascaíocht na n-úsáide le cláir a chruthú le teanga ríomhchláraithe Pascal, ar teanga ilúsáideach í atá bunaithe ar orduithe a roinneann roinnt tréithe go mór le C.
leibhéil teanga cláir
Roinntear teangacha ríomhchlárúcháin i leibhéil éagsúla, mar a leanas:
teangacha ardleibhéil
I measc na samplaí tá: C Sharp, C, Python, Fortran, Ruby, Php, Pascal, JavaScript, SQL, C++.
teangacha ísealleibhéil
Tá sé roinnte ina theanga meaisín agus teanga tionóil, agus tugtar íseal air mar gheall ar an mbearna leathan idir é agus teanga an duine.
Glúine teangacha ríomhchlárúcháin
Ní hamháin gur roinneadh teangacha ríomhchlárúcháin de réir a leibhéil, ach tháinig deighilt le déanaí de réir na nglún ina raibh siad le feiceáil, mar atá:
1ú glúin (XNUMXGL)
Ar a dtugtar teanga meaisín, tá sé bunaithe go príomha ar an gcóras comhairimh dhénártha (1.0) chun an méid atá scríofa i dtéarmaí oibríochtaí uimhríochtúil agus loighciúil a léiriú.
dara glúin (2GL)
Tugadh teanga tionóil air, agus déantar teangacha sa ghlúin seo a ghiorrú go cúpla ordú, frása, agus siombail a úsáidtear chun orduithe a iontráil.
An tríú glúin (3GL)
Áiríonn sé teangacha nós imeachta ardleibhéil, agus is sainairíonna é go mbraitheann sé ar theanga atá intuigthe ag an duine a chomhcheangal le roinnt siombailí matamaitice agus loighciúla a bhfuil aithne mhaith orthu agus iad a scríobh ar bhealach a thuigeann ríomhaire.
4ú glúin (XNUMXGL)
Is teangacha ardleibhéil neamh-nós imeachta iad, tá siad níos soláimhsithe ná na glúine roimhe seo, agus tá siad uathúil chun an próiseas a aisiompú; Nuair a insíonn an ríomhchláraitheoir an toradh inmhianaithe dá ríomhaire; Déanann an dara ceann iad a bhaint amach go huathoibríoch, agus is iad na cineálacha is suntasaí ná: bunachair shonraí, táblaí leictreonacha.
An cúigiú glúin (5GL)
Is teangacha nádúrtha iad, a tháinig chun cur ar chumas an ríomhaire a chuid oibre ríomhchlárúcháin a dhéanamh gan gá le ríomhchláraitheoir saineolaí chun an cód a scríobh go mion, agus braitheann sé go príomha ar hintleachta saorga.
Agus tá tú i sláinte agus folláine is fearr ár leantóirí dearfacha